Chantal Sutherland : “I’m living my dream again”

At 1h24, on May 28, 2022 By GULFSTREAM

Fresh off notching her 23rd graded-stakes victory aboard Lightening Larry in last Saturday’s Chick Lang (G3) at Pimlico Race Course on the Preakness Stakes (G1) undercard, Chantal Sutherland is scheduled to ride well-regarded contenders in both the $75,000 Big Drama and the $60,000 Sunny Isles Saturday at Gulfstream Park.

“I’m living my dream again,” Sutherland said Thursday between races at Gulfstream. “I’m loving it. I feel great and healthy.”

The Big Drama, a six-furlong sprint for Florida-bred 3-year-olds and up carded as Race 11, and the Sunny Isles, a five-furlong overnight handicap on turf for 3-year-olds and up carded as Race 6, will be co-featured on a 12-race program.

The victory aboard Lea Farms LLC’s Lightening Larry was Sutherland’s first graded-stakes success since 2014 and a giant step forward in the career revival she has achieved through a rededication to her craft since switching her tack from Kentucky to Gulfstream Park in the Spring of 2021.

“It was very rewarding. With Covid and injuries and taking time off, it’s kind of all lining up, coming together,” said Sutherland, who rode Game On Dude to five graded-stakes victories n 2011 and 2012, including three Grade 1 scores. “It’s a testament to all the hard work I’ve put in and the focus I have. There are no distractions right now.”
